I am a nuvi 750 user. I bought a gomadic battery charger couple days ago for extending my 750 battery life during the long trip. But the thing is that the battery did not work at all. It only worked as the internal battery is alive. It won't charge the 750 internal battery. I used rechargedable battery. I set brightness 50%. The longest hour I used with battery box is 5 hours. That does not really help anything. Does anyone has same problem?

gomadic AA charger
I got exactly the same problem with this one
http://www.gomadic.com/garmin-nuvi-250-emergency-aa-battery-...
it totally sucked and I returned it...
1. It couldn't take 4 AA rechargeable batteries - I tried with sanyo and powerex, the box was too small. I know rechargeables are bit bigger than standard batteries but gomadic state their device works with them
2. When I finally got to plug in my device and left it overnight it actually drained my nuvi battery instead of charging it
3. It would be nice if the cable was shorter so you could somehow attach the device to your unit if used on the track...
